Two pendulums have time period T and 5T/4. They starts SHM at the same time from the mean position. What will be the phase difference between them after the bigger pendulum completed one oscillation ?

A

`45^(@)`

B

`90^(@)`

C

`60^(@)`

D

`30^(@)`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

When a bigger pendulum of `T_(1)=5T//4` complete one vibration, the smalle pendulum will complete 5/4 vibration. It means the smaller pendulum will be leading, the bigger pendulum by phase T/4 sec = `(pi)/(2)` rad = `90^(@)`
